text-align: justify;\">The Presidential Decree 039, emitted on January 14, 2021, and the Departmental Decree 048, in the Second and Third Articles, guarantee the freedom of movement of the humanitarian agents that provide essential rescue services in coordination with agencies of the Colombian State.<\/p>\n<p style=\"font-weight: 400; text-align: justify;\">The\u00a0<a href=\"https:\/\/www.fraterinternacional.org\/en\/colombia-mission\/\">Humanitarian Colombia Mission<\/a>\u00a0became a permanent mission as of 2018, in response to the worsening of the humanitarian crisis experienced by Venezuelan immigrants that reached the country, and the inner displacement of the Colombians themselves caused by guerrillas and other situations of vulnerability.<\/p>\n<p style=\"font-weight: 400; text-align: justify;\">\u201cIn accordance with the protocols determined by the World Health Organization (WHO), the places of attention where the activities of the Humanitarian Colombia Mission were carried out \u2013 the SuperCade Social of the Terminal de\u00a0Transportes\u00a0El\u00a0Salitre\u00a0and the Secretariat of the Government of Bogota -, were closed indefinitely due to the Covid-19 pandemic,\u201d explains Anderson Santiago, a volunteer missionary.<\/p>\n<h3 style=\"text-align: justify;\"><b><span lang=\"EN-US\">Developed Activities<\/span><\/b><\/h3>\n<p style=\"font-weight: 400; text-align: justify;\">The principal activities are developed mainly with children, adolescents and young people, using the tools of education in emergency to develop an environment of protection and the strengthening of resilience in those faced with a humanitarian crisis.
